American Sign Language Name Sign for VP Kamala Harris
An American sign language sign name was given to Kamala Harris right after she got elected as president Joe Biden’s vice president. VP Harris' name sign was made by a team of Black and Indian Deaf women, Smita Kothari, Ebony Gooden, Kavita Pipalia, and Candace Jones, who worked with one another for several weeks. This women’s group worked together to come up with a list of possible sign names and afterwards sent out a survey to the Deaf community at large to gather their votes from February 1 to 5, 2021.
Deaf culture consists of several valued traditional aspects that happen to be essential to the Deaf community, and one of them is the “name sign.” A name sign is actually a sign that's solely given to the person, and it is frequently made according to the individual's traits, character, likes and dislikes, and so on, which in turn uniquely and distinctively identify an individual. A name sign takes on an important role in defining who the person is as well as their personal identity.
